在平日飲食計畫中,納入適量的抗性澱粉,將有助於吃出健康。 將主食從白米、白麵條、白麵包,改成糙米、燕麥、蕎麥、全麥麵條、全麥麵包等。 因為種子類、豆莢類及未加工全穀類所含的抗性澱粉較多。
臺安醫院家醫科主任羅佳琳指出,抗性澱粉具有難消化吸收的屬性,類同於低升糖食物(低GI)

Colon tumor cells proliferation and dedifferentiation were significantly decreased by a resistant starch diet. The results also demonstrated that resistant starch increased the apoptosis of colon tumor cells through regulation of apoptosis-associated gene expression levels in colon tumor cells.
抗性澱粉飲食顯著降低了結腸腫瘤細胞的增殖和去分化。結果還表明,抗性澱粉通過調節結腸腫瘤細胞中凋亡相關基因的表達水平來增加結腸腫瘤細胞的凋亡。
